THE OPPORTUNITY

Rural City of Wangaratta seeks an enthusiastic, suitably qualified and experienced arborist to be a valued member of our Arboriculture Team. The person we are seeking will be enthusiastic about trees, have appropriate experience of tree management works, from planting, formative pruning and establishing newly planted trees, to the full range of tree inspection, assessment, maintenance, pruning and removal works. They will have experience in the operation of a range of mechanical plant and equipment including wood chipper, elevated work platform and pneumatic saws and have recognised arboriculture climbing skills.

Responsibilities:

ROLE REQUIREMENTS:

  • Qualifications: Minimum Certificate III in Arboriculture, supplemented by relevant certificates and qualifications.
  • Experience: Proven track record in tree management works, including climbing, pruning, and operation of specialized equipment.
  • Team Player: Strong commitment to teamwork, safety, and collaborative problem-solving.
  • Essential Certifications: Hold a Level 2 First Aid Certificate and a valid medium rigid driver’s license.
